What should be in a startup pitch deck?

Most early decks need a clear problem, solution, market, traction, business model, team, roadmap, and ask.

When should founders build a pitch deck?

Build the first version once the problem, customer, and early validation are clear enough to explain.

Can AI write the whole deck?

AI can help structure the deck and sharpen language, but the founder must supply real evidence, judgment, and conviction.

Is this only for fundraising?

No. Pitch materials also help founders align teams, mentors, partners, and accelerator programs.
